ANNA'S APPLE, BANANA & PEAR CARAMELY PUDDING

Serves 4

INGREDIENTS:

2 large or 3 meduim bananas

2 meduim-large crisp dessert apples

2 pears

a knob of butter

1 Tablespoon sunflower oil

2 Tablespoons soft brown sugar

DIRECTIONS:

Preheat the oven to 190 degree C.

Peel the bananas, half them lenthways & cut each half into two.

Put into an oven dish.

Peel the apples & pears, half or quarter them & remove the cores, then add to dish.

Add the butter, then the oil (which will stop the butter burning) & place in the oven for 10 minutes.

Take the dish from the oven & give the whole thing a gentle stir to distribute the butter over all the fruit.

Return to the oven for 10 minutes, then take it out again.

Sprinkle over the sugar, stir gently & return to the oven for a further 10 minutes or until everything is soft & buttery, sugary juices are starting to caramelise.

Serve at once, with plain yoghurt, cream or ice cream, & short bread if you want.

Plus one: A few toasted nuts- roughly bashed walnuts, pecans or slivered almonds, toasted in a hot oven for 5-10 minutes until lightly browned-make an extra delicious finishing touch.
